Файл: WM-Koder/anketa.php
Строк: 405
<?php
require 'system/sid.php';
require 'system/config.php';
if (!empty($_SESSION['us']))
{
include 'system/user.php';
whorm(0, 'anketa');
}
include 'system/head.php';
include 'system/navigator.php';
$nk = my_int($_GET['nk']);
if (!user_inf($nk))
{
header('Location: index.php?');
die();
}
$do = (isset($_GET['do'])) ? $_GET['do'] : NULL;
switch($do) {
default:
if ($user['id'] == $nk)
{
echo '<div class="title">Анкета '.cvetnik($user['id']).'</div>';
echo '<div class="menu">';
$rot = mysql_fetch_array(mysql_query("SELECT `rotate`, `block` FROM `albums` WHERE `path` = '$user[img]' AND `user` = '$user[id]' AND `type` = 'f'"));
if ($rot[1] == 1)
{
$Foto = '<img src="/views/default/img/no_avatar.gif" alt=""/><br><br>';
}
else
{
$Foto = '<img src="/resize.php?img='.$user_inf['img'].'&width=128&height=0&i='.$rot[0].'" alt="*"/><br><br>';
}
if ($user_inf['img'] != '')
{
echo $Foto;
}
else
{
echo '<img src="/views/default/img/no_avatar.gif" alt="*"/><br><br>';
}
if ($user['level'] == 0) echo '<div class="menu3"><b>Ранг:</b> Пользователь<br/></div>';
elseif ($user['level'] == 1) echo '<div class="menu3"><b>Ранг:</b> Пользователь<br/></div>';
elseif ($user['level'] == 2) echo '<div class="menu3"><b>Ранг:</b> Модератор<br/></div>';
elseif ($user['level'] == 3) echo '<div class="menu3"><b>Ранг:</b> Гл.Модератор<br/></div>';
elseif ($user['level'] == 4) echo '<div class="menu3"><b>Ранг:</b> Администратор<br/></div>';
elseif ($user['level'] == 5) echo '<div class="menu3"><b>Ранг:</b> Гл.Админ<br/></div>';
// всего друзей
$num_fr_1 = mysql_result(mysql_query("SELECT COUNT(id) FROM `friends` WHERE `who` = '$user[id]' AND `zajavka` = '1'"), 0);
// непринятых заявок
$num_fr_2 = mysql_result(mysql_query("SELECT COUNT(id) FROM `friends` WHERE `who` = '$user[id]' AND `zajavka` = '0'"), 0);
// фотоальбомов
$num_album = mysql_result(mysql_query("SELECT COUNT(id) FROM `albums` WHERE `user` = '$user[id]' AND `type` = 'a'"), 0);
// фотографий
$num_foto = mysql_result(mysql_query("SELECT COUNT(id) FROM `albums` WHERE `user` = '$user[id]' AND `type` = 'f'"), 0);
if ($user['know'] == 1) $Kn = 'Кодер';
elseif ($user['know'] == 2) $Kn = 'Дизайнер';
elseif ($user['know'] == 3) $Kn = 'Мастер';
elseif ($user['know'] == 4) $Kn = 'Продавец';
elseif ($user['know'] == 5) $Kn = 'Кредитор';
else $Kn = '-';
if (!empty($user['wmid']))
{
$wm = '<img src="/views/icon/wmid.png" alt="."/> <b>WMID:</b> <a href="http://passport.webmoney.ru/asp/certview.asp?wmid='.$user['wmid'].'">' . $user['wmid'] . '</a><br/>
<b>BL</b>: <img src="http://stats.wmtransfer.com/Levels/pWMIDLevel.aspx?wmid='.$user['wmid'].'&w=35&h=18&bg=0XDBE2E9" alt="WMID"/><br/>
<b>Претензии/Отзывы/Иски:</b> <img src="http://arbitrage.webmoney.ru/xml/AL2.aspx?wmid='.$user['wmid'].'" alt="П/О/И"/><br/>';
}
if (!empty($user['birth']))
{
$birth = '<b>Возраст:</b> ' . calc_age($user['birth']) . ' (' . zodiak($user['birth']) . ')<br/>';
}
echo '<div class="menu3"><b>Ник:</b> '.$user['user'].'</div>
<div class="menu3"><b>IP:</b> '.$user['ip'].'</div>
<div class="menu3"><b>Статус:</b> '.$user['status'].'</div>
<div class="menu3"><b>Настоящее имя:</b> '.$user['name'].'</div>
<div class="menu3"><b>Уровень:</b> '.$Kn.'</div>
<div class="menu">' . $wm . '</div>
' . (!empty($user['kosh']) ? '<div class="menu3"><b>Кошелек:</b> '.$user['kosh'].'</div>' : '') . '
<div class="menu3"><b>Страна:</b> '.$user['strana'].'</div>
<div class="menu3"><b>Город:</b> '.$user['gorod'].'</div>
<div class="menu3"><b>Мобильный телефон:</b> '.$user['phone'].'</div>
<div class="menu3"><b>Оператор:</b> '.$user['operator'].'</div>
<div class="menu3"><b>Пол:</b> ' . ($user['sex'] == 1 ? 'Женский' : 'Мужской') . '</div>
<div class="menu3">' . $birth . '</div>
<div class="menu3"><b>Лучших ответов форума:</b> ' . forumBest($user['id']) . '</div>
<div class="menu3"><b>Худших ответов форума:</b> ' . forumWorse($user['id']) . '</div>
' . (!empty($user['email']) ? '<div class="menu3"><b>Email:</b> ' . $user['email'] . '</div>' : '') . '
' . (!empty($user['icq']) ? '<div class="menu3"><b>ICQ:</b> ' . $user['icq'] . '</div>' : '') . '
<div class="menu3"><b>Сайт:</b> <a href="http://'.$user['sait'].'">'.$user['sait'].'</a></div>
<div class="menu3"><b>Репутация:</b> (+' . $user['rating_plus'] . '/-' . $user['rating_minus'] . ')</div>
<div class="menu3"><b>Дата регистрации:</b> '.$user['date'].'</div>
<div class="menu3"><b>Провел на сайте:</b> '.makestime($user['on_time']).'</div>
<div class="menu3"><b>Баланс:</b> '.$user['money'].' монет | <a href="/page/13">Купить</a><br/></div></div></div>
<div class="menu"><a href="/user/profile/edit.php"><span class="ssyl2">Изменить</span></a></div>
<div class="menu"><a href="friends.php"><span class="ssyl2">Друзья <b>'.$num_fr_1.'</b></span></a></div>
<div class="menu"><a href="photo.php"><span class="ssyl2">Фотоальбом (' . $num_album . '/' . $num_foto . ')</span></a></div>
<div class="menu"><a href="cabinet.php"><span class="ssyl2">В кабинет</span></a></div>';
}
else
{
$lastv = (user_inf($nk, 'sex') == 1)?'Последний раз была: ':'Последний раз был: ';
echo '<div class="title">Анкета '.cvetnik($nk).''.$vis.'</div>';
echo '<div class="menu">';
if (user_inf($nk, 'kik') != '' && user_inf($nk, 'kik') > time()){
echo '<div class="menu">Пользователь заблокирован за '.user_inf($nk, 'whykik').'</div>';}
if (user_inf($nk, 'mod_reg') == 1){
echo '<div class="menu">Пользователь еще не прошел модерацию</div>';}
$rot = mysql_fetch_array(mysql_query("SELECT `rotate`, `block` FROM `albums` WHERE `path` = '".user_inf($nk, 'img')."' AND `user` = '$nk' AND `type` = 'f'"));
if ($rot[1] == 1){
$Foto = '<img src="/views/default/img/no_avatar.gif" alt=""/><br><br>';}else{
$Foto = '<img src="/resize.php?img='.$user_inf['img'].'&width=128&height=0&i='.$rot[0].'" alt="*"/><br><br>';}
if ($user_inf['img'] != ''){
echo $Foto;}else{
echo '<img src="/views/default/img/no_avatar.gif" alt="*"/><br><br>';}
if ($user['level'] >= 1 && $user['level'] <= 3)
{
$adult = $div_tworazdel . 'Действие:<br/>
<FORM method="POST" action="moder.php?do=us_adult">
<select name="adult">
<option value="1">Забанить ник</option>
<option value="2">Забанить ip</option>
</select>
<br/>
<input type="hidden" name="nick" value="' . $nk . '"/>
<input type="submit" name="ok" value="Далее"/>
</FORM>' . $div_end;
}
elseif ($user['level'] == 4 || $user['level'] == 5)
{
$adult = $div_tworazdel . 'Действие:<br/>
<FORM method="POST" action="admin.php?do=us_adult">
<select name="adult">
<option value="1">Забанить ник</option>
<option value="2">Забанить ip</option>
<option value="3">Удалить ник</option>
<option value="4">Поиск по IP</option>
<option value="5">Поиск по IP (подсеть)</option>
<option value="6">Апдейт</option>
</select>
<br/>
<input type="hidden" name="nick" value="' . $nk . '"/>
<input type="submit" name="ok" value="Далее"/>
</FORM>' . $div_end;
}
echo '<div class="menu3"><b>Ник:</b> '.user_inf($nk, 'user').'</div><div class="text-align:right;padding:4px;">' . $adult . '</div>';
if (user_inf($nk, 'level') == 0) echo '<div class="menu3"><b>Ранг:</b> Пользователь</div>';
elseif (user_inf($nk, 'level') == 1) echo '<div class="menu3"><b>Ранг:</b> Пользователь</div>';
elseif (user_inf($nk, 'level') == 2) echo '<div class="menu3"><b>Ранг:</b> Модератор</div>';
elseif (user_inf($nk, 'level') == 3) echo '<div class="menu3"><b>Ранг:</b> Ст.Модератор</div>';
elseif (user_inf($nk, 'level') == 4) echo '<div class="menu3"><b>Ранг:</b> Администратор</div>';
elseif (user_inf($nk, 'level') == 5) echo '<div class="menu3"><b>Ранг:</b> Ст.Админ</div>';
// всего друзей
$num_fr_1 = mysql_result(mysql_query("SELECT COUNT(id) FROM `friends` WHERE `who` = '$nk' AND `zajavka` = '1'"), 0);
// общих друзей
$num_fr_2 = mysql_result(mysql_query("SELECT COUNT(id) FROM `friends` WHERE `user` = '$nk' AND `who` IN(SELECT `who` FROM `friends` WHERE `user` = '$user[id]') AND `zajavka` = '1'"), 0);
// фотоальбомов
$num_album = mysql_result(mysql_query("SELECT COUNT(id) FROM `albums` WHERE `user` = '$nk' AND `type` = 'a'"), 0);
// фотографий
$num_foto = mysql_result(mysql_query("SELECT COUNT(id) FROM `albums` WHERE `user` = '$nk' AND `type` = 'f'"), 0);
if (user_inf($nk, 'know') == 1) $Kn = 'Кодер';
elseif (user_inf($nk, 'know') == 2) $Kn = 'Дизайнер';
elseif (user_inf($nk, 'know') == 3) $Kn = 'Мастер';
elseif (user_inf($nk, 'know') == 4) $Kn = 'Продавец';
elseif (user_inf($nk, 'know') == 5) $Kn = 'Кредитор';
else $Kn = '-';
#################################################
$fr = mysql_query("SELECT COUNT(id) FROM `friends` WHERE
`user` = '$user[id]'
AND
`who` = '$nk'
AND
`zajavka` = '1'
OR
`user` = '$nk'
AND
`who` = '$user[id]'
AND
`zajavka` = '1'");
$fr_1 = mysql_query("SELECT COUNT(id) FROM `friends` WHERE
`user` = '$user[id]'
AND
`who` = '$nk'
AND
`zajavka` = '0'");
$fr_2 = mysql_query("SELECT COUNT(id) FROM `friends` WHERE
`user` = '$nk'
AND
`who` = '$user[id]'
AND
`zajavka` = '0'");
if (user_inf($nk, 'p_friends') == 1)
{
$myfr = '<div class="menu3"><a href="friends.php?do=view&nk='.$nk.'">Друзья</a> <b>'.$num_fr_1.'</b></div>';
}
elseif (user_inf($nk, 'p_friends') == 2)
{
$myfr = '';
}
elseif (user_inf($nk, 'p_friends') == 0 && mysql_result($fr, 0) != FALSE)
{
$myfr = '<div class="menu3"><a href="friends.php?do=view&nk='.$nk.'">Друзья</a> <b>'.$num_fr_1.'</b></div>';
}
if (mysql_result($fr_1, 0) != FALSE) {
$add_friend = '<span style="color: #064a91;">Вы отправили заявку на дружбу</span>';
} elseif (mysql_result($fr_2, 0) != FALSE) {
$add_friend = '<span style="color: #064a91;">Пользователь отправил Вам заявку на дружбу</span>';
} elseif (mysql_result($fr, 0) == FALSE) {
$add_friend = '<a class="ssyl2" href="friends.php?do=add_new&nk='.$nk.'">Добавить в друзья</a>';
} else {
$add_friend = '<a class="ssyl2" href="friends.php?x='.$nk.'">Убрать из друзей</a>';
}
#################################################
if (user_inf($nk, 'wmid') != 0)
{
$wm = '<div class="menu"><img src="/views/icon/wmid.png" alt="."/> <b>WMID:</b> <a href="http://passport.webmoney.ru/asp/certview.asp?wmid='.user_inf($nk, 'wmid').'">' . user_inf($nk, 'wmid') . '</a><br/>
<b>BL:</b> <img src="http://stats.wmtransfer.com/Levels/pWMIDLevel.aspx?wmid='.user_inf($nk, 'wmid').'&w=35&h=18&bg=0XDBE2E9" alt="WMID"/><br/>
<b>Претензии/Отзывы/Иски:</b> <img src="http://arbitrage.webmoney.ru/xml/AL2.aspx?wmid='.user_inf($nk, 'wmid').'" alt="П/О/И"/></div>';
}
echo '<div class="menu3"><b>IP:</b> '.user_inf($nk, 'ip').'</div>
<div class="menu3"><b>Статус:</b> ' . user_inf($nk, 'name') . '</div>
<div class="menu3"><b>Настоящее имя:</b> ' . user_inf($nk, 'name') . '</div>
<div class="menu3"><b>Уровень:</b> ' . $Kn . '</div>
' . $wm . '
<div class="menu3"><img src="/views/icon/kosh.png" alt="."/> <b>Кошелек:</b> ' . user_inf($nk, 'kosh') . '</div>
<div class="menu3"><b>Страна:</b> ' . user_inf($nk, 'strana') . '</div>
<div class="menu3"><b>Город:</b> ' . user_inf($nk, 'gorod') . '</div>
<div class="menu3"><b>Мобильный телефон:</b> ' . user_inf($nk, 'uvle') . '</div>
<div class="menu3"><b>Skype:</b> ' . user_inf($nk, 'skype') . '</div>
<div class="menu3"><b>Email:</b> ' . user_inf($nk, 'email') . '</div>
<div class="menu3"><b>ICQ:</b> ' . user_inf($nk, 'icq') . '</div>
<div class="menu3"><b>Пол:</b> ' . (user_inf($nk, 'sex') == 1 ? 'Женский' : 'Мужской') . '</div>
<div class="menu3"><b>Возраст:</b> ' . calc_age(user_inf($nk, 'birth')) . '</div>
<div class="menu3"><b>Репутация:</b> ' . (user_inf($nk, 'rating_plus') - user_inf($nk, 'rating_minus')) . '</div>
<div class="menu3"><b>Дата регистрации:</b> ' . user_inf($nk, 'date') . '</div>
<div class="menu3"><b>Провел на сайте:</b> ' . makestime(user_inf($nk, 'on_time')) . '</div>
<div class="menu3"><b>Лучших ответов форума:</b> ' . forumBest($nk) . '</div>
<div class="menu3"><b>Худших ответов форума:</b> ' . forumWorse($nk) . '</div>';
if (isset($_SESSION['us']))
{
echo '<div class="menu"><a class="ssyl2" href="mail.php?do=send&nick='.$nk.'">Написать сообщение</a></div>
<div class="menu"><a class="ssyl2" href="photo.php?do=view&nk='.$nk.'">Фотографии (' . $num_album . '/' . $num_foto . ')</a></div>
<div class="menu"><a class="ssyl2" href="friends.php?do=view&nk='.$nk.'">Друзья <b>' . $num_fr_1 . '</b></a></div>
<div class="menu">' . $add_friend . '</div></div>';
}
}
break;
case themes_user:
$nk = my_int($_REQUEST['nk']);
echo $div_title . 'Темы пользователя на форуме' . $div_end;
if (!user_inf($nk)) {
err('Пользователь не найден!');
include 'system/foot.php';
exit();
}
$countT = mysql_result(mysql_query("SELECT COUNT(id) FROM `f_them` WHERE `author` = '$nk'"), 0);
if ($countT != 0) {
echo 'Всего тем: ' . $countT . $block;
$n = new navigator($countT, 10, '?do=themes_user&nk='.$nk.'&');
$th = mysql_query("SELECT `f_them`.*, (SELECT COUNT(id) FROM `f_message` WHERE `user` = '$nk' AND `f_them`.`id` = `f_message`.`tid`) AS c FROM `f_them` WHERE `author` = '$nk' ORDER BY `id` DESC {$n->limit}");
$i = 0;
while($inTh = mysql_fetch_assoc($th))
{
echo ($i ++ % 2) ? $div_tworazdel : $div_razdel;
echo '» <a href="forum/index.php?do=them&r='.$inTh['razdel_id'].'&p='.$inTh['rid'].'&t='.$inTh['id'].'">' . $inTh['name'] . '</a> (' . $inTh['c'] . ')' . $div_end;
}
echo $n->navi();
} else {
echo 'Тем не найдено.<br/>';
}
break;
case posts_user:
$nk = my_int($_REQUEST['nk']);
echo $div_title . 'Сообщения пользователя на форуме' . $div_end;
if (!user_inf($nk)) {
err('Пользователь не найден!');
include 'system/foot.php';
exit();
}
$countT = mysql_result(mysql_query("SELECT COUNT(id) FROM `f_message` WHERE `user` = '$nk'"), 0);
if ($countT != 0) {
echo 'Всего сообщений: ' . $countT . $block;
$n = new navigator($countT, 10, '?do=posts_user&nk='.$nk.'&');
$th = mysql_query("SELECT `f_message`.*, (SELECT `razdel_id` FROM `f_them` WHERE `f_message`.`tid` = `f_them`.`id`) AS c FROM `f_message` WHERE `user` = '$nk' ORDER BY `id` DESC {$n->limit}");
$i = 0;
while($inTh = mysql_fetch_assoc($th)) {
echo ($i ++ % 2) ? $div_tworazdel : $div_razdel;
echo '» <a href="forum/index.php?do=them&r='.$inTh['c'].'&p='.$inTh['podforum'].'&t='.$inTh['tid'].'">' . $inTh['msg'] . '</a>' . $div_end;
}
echo $n->navi();
} else {
echo 'Сообщений не найдено.<br/>';
}
break;
}
include 'system/foot.php';
?>